GC17 ENP is a 2017 Ssangyong Korando in Grey with a 2,157c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2017 Ssangyong Korando models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.4% with a typical mileage of 42,475 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ssangyong Korando f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 803 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GC17 ENP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ssangyong Korando typ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 9 years old, this Ssangyong Korando is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
